Flooding: Kwara Assembly urges KWSG to clear drainage

Date: 2019-05-03

The Kwara State House of Assembly has called on the state government to direct its Ministry of Environment and Forestry to embark on the clearing of drainages across the state to prevent flooding.

The call was contained in the resolutions the lawmakers made following a Matter of Urgent Public Importance raised by the member representing Oke Ogun Constituency, Kamal Fagbemi, titled, "Incessant flooding during the rainy season in the state."

The Deputy Speaker, Chief Mathew Okedare, while reading the resolutions of the House on the matter, said the call became imperative because of the need to ensure free flow of water during the rainy season.

This, he said, would also prevent flooding that regularly wreaked havoc on some areas of the state during the rainy season.

Fagbemi had while raising the matter observed with displeasure the indiscriminate dumping of refuse in the drainages during rainfalls and the poor performance of the local councils' sanitary inspectors.

Other members who spoke on the matter emphasised the need for relevant agencies, ministry and councils to be alive to their responsibilities in tackling flooding.
